يمكنك تعلم تطوير المواقع من خلال البدء بأساسيات الويب مثل HTML وCSS وJavaScript، ثم الانتقال تدريجياً إلى المشاريع العملية وأدوات التطوير الحديثة حتى تصل إلى مستوى الاحتراف.
تعلم تطوير المواقع لا يحتاج شهادة أو خلفية تقنية مسبقة، بل يعتمد على خطة واضحة، وممارسة مستمرة، وبناء مشاريع حقيقية خطوة بخطوة.
أولاً: فهم أساسيات تطوير المواقع
ابدأ بالأساسيات لأنها حجر الأساس:
1. HTML (هيكل الموقع)
- تستخدم لبناء صفحات الويب
- تحدد العناصر مثل العناوين، الفقرات، الصور، والروابط
2. CSS (تصميم الموقع)
- مسؤولة عن الشكل والألوان والتنسيق
- تجعل الموقع جذاباً وسهل الاستخدام
3. JavaScript (التفاعل)
- تضيف الحركة والتفاعل
- مثل الأزرار الديناميكية والنماذج التفاعلية
ثانياً: اختيار مصادر تعلم جيدة
اختر مصادر موثوقة:
- دورات مجانية على الإنترنت
- قنوات تعليمية متخصصة
- مواقع مثل MDN وfreeCodeCamp
الأهم هو الالتزام بمصدر واحد في البداية لتجنب التشتت.
ثالثاً: التطبيق العملي
التعلم بدون تطبيق غير كافٍ:
- أنشئ موقعاً بسيطاً لنفسك
- صمم صفحة تعريف شخصية
- حاول تقليد مواقع بسيطة
كل مشروع يساعدك على تثبيت المعلومات.
رابعاً: تعلم أدوات التطوير
بعد الأساسيات:
- استخدم محرر أكواد مثل VS Code
- تعلم Git وGitHub لحفظ مشاريعك
- استخدم أدوات المتصفح لفحص الأخطاء
خامساً: التوسع في التقنيات الحديثة
بعد إتقان الأساسيات:
- تعلم React أو Vue لتطوير واجهات حديثة
- تعرف على Backend مثل Node.js أو PHP
- تعلم قواعد البيانات مثل MySQL أو MongoDB
سادساً: بناء مشاريع حقيقية
- متجر إلكتروني بسيط
- مدونة شخصية
- موقع خدمات أو Portfolio
المشاريع هي أفضل طريقة للتعلم.
نصائح مهمة
- لا تحاول تعلم كل شيء مرة واحدة
- خصص وقتاً يومياً للتدريب
- لا تخف من الأخطاء فهي جزء من التعلم
- ابحث دائماً عن حلول بنفسك
الخلاصة
تعلم تطوير المواقع يعتمد على إتقان HTML وCSS وJavaScript، ثم التطبيق العملي، وبعدها التوسع في الأدوات والتقنيات الحديثة. ومع الاستمرار وبناء المشاريع، يمكنك الانتقال من مبتدئ إلى مطور مواقع محترف بثقة وكفاءة.
